Making Sense of Madness: Contesting the Meaning of Schizophrenia - The International Society for Psychological and Social Approaches to Psychosis Book Series Jim Geekie 1.º edición
Making Sense of Madness: Contesting the Meaning of Schizophrenia - The International Society for Psychological and Social Approaches to Psychosis Book Series
Jim Geekie
This book argues that the experience of 'madness' is an integral part of what it is to be human, and that greater focus on subjective experiences can contribute to professional understandings and ways of helping those troubled by these experiences.
